A collection of silverware is suspended in time in this backsplash. Resin is poured into a form and the utensils are embedded into the material. The finished panels are mounted to the backsplash area.
Here are some things to consider when you install engineered countertops. Engineered stone countertops are heat and scratch resistant and most are non-porous so they are also moisture resistant. Engineered stone countertops come in a variety of styles and colors. Man-made colors can be controlled so there are many more color options than natural stone. These engineered countertops are a durable and versatile alternative to natural stone.
